Dynamic DNS Services: Enhancing Accessibility for Remote Workers

The advent of remote work has transformed the traditional office landscape, making accessibility to corporate networks and resources paramount for remote workers. Dynamic Domain Name System (DNS) services have emerged as a crucial technology in facilitating seamless and secure connectivity for remote employees. This article explores the role of dynamic DNS services in enhancing accessibility for remote workers, addressing the challenges of dynamic IP addresses, ensuring secure connections, and optimizing the overall remote work experience.

I. Understanding Dynamic DNS:

  1. Dynamic IP Addresses and Remote Connectivity:

    • Remote workers often connect to corporate networks using internet service providers that assign dynamic IP addresses. Dynamic DNS provides a solution for the challenges posed by these changing IP addresses, ensuring a consistent and easily accessible connection.
  2. Dynamic DNS vs. Static DNS:

    • Unlike static DNS, which associates a fixed IP address with a domain, dynamic DNS allows for the automatic update of IP addresses associated with a domain name. This flexibility is essential for remote workers whose IP addresses may change frequently.

II. Challenges of Remote Connectivity:

  1. Changing IP Addresses:

    • Remote workers connecting from home or various locations may encounter changing IP addresses due to dynamic assignment by their internet service providers. Static DNS becomes impractical in such scenarios, necessitating the use of dynamic DNS services.
  2. Network Accessibility and Firewalls:

    • Firewalls and network restrictions in different locations can impede remote workers' ability to connect to corporate resources. Dynamic DNS helps overcome these obstacles by providing a consistent domain name, simplifying the process of accessing internal systems.

III. The Role of Dynamic DNS in Remote Work:

  1. Consistent Access to Corporate Resources:

    • Dynamic DNS services enable remote workers to access corporate resources using a fixed domain name, regardless of the changing IP addresses assigned by ISPs. This consistency is crucial for maintaining seamless connectivity.
  2. Remote Desktop and File Access:

    • Remote desktop applications and file access rely on stable connections. Dynamic DNS ensures that remote workers can consistently connect to their office computers or access shared files securely, regardless of their location.

IV. Security Considerations:

  1. SSL Certificates and Secure Connections:

    • Implementing SSL certificates in conjunction with dynamic DNS enhances security by encrypting data transmitted between remote workers and corporate networks. This ensures that sensitive information remains confidential during remote access.
  2. Two-Factor Authentication (2FA):

    • Dynamic DNS services can be integrated with two-factor authentication mechanisms, adding an extra layer of security to remote connections. This mitigates the risk of unauthorized access and enhances the overall security posture for remote workers.

V. Choosing and Configuring Dynamic DNS Services:

  1. Dynamic DNS Service Providers:

    • Several service providers offer dynamic DNS services, each with its features and capabilities. Evaluating providers based on reliability, update frequency, and support for various devices is essential for choosing the right service.
  2. Configuration for Remote Work:

    • Configuring dynamic DNS for remote work involves setting up the service on the corporate network's router or server. Remote workers configure their devices to use the dynamic DNS domain name, ensuring seamless and secure access.

VI. Benefits of Dynamic DNS in Remote Work:

  1. Enhanced Productivity:

    • Dynamic DNS contributes to enhanced productivity for remote workers by eliminating the need to track changing IP addresses. Workers can focus on their tasks without disruptions related to connectivity issues.
  2. Simplified IT Management:

    • IT administrators benefit from simplified management of remote access. Dynamic DNS automates the process of updating IP addresses, reducing the administrative burden and ensuring that resources are consistently accessible.
